How Td Bank Cd Rates Actually Work
Certificates of Deposit at Td Bank are time-bound savings accounts that offer a fixed interest rate in exchange for locking funds for a defined period—from a few months to several years. Interest accrues daily but is only accessible upon maturity or early withdrawal with potential penalty fees. The returns are often higher than traditional checking or money market accounts, appealing to users seeking reliable, risk-controlled growth. Rates vary by term length, with longer terms typically offering better yields—though liquidity decreases accordingly.
Common Questions About Td Bank Cd Rates
How long do Td Bank CDs typically last?
Terms range from 3 to 36 months, allowing flexibility based on personal financial goals and expected access.
